One of the biggest multi-node telecommunications systems has been installed in record time at Polifin Midlands site, Sasolburg, by Philips Business Communications, without interrupting working operations.
The entire cutover was completed over a single weekend to allow Polifin staff to return to work on the Monday with a new, fully operational system in place. In all, 1200 Telkom phones were replaced with PBC systems.
Excellent teamwork by PBC and Polifin staff, who planned the operation with military precision, made this achievement possible just four months after finalisation of the contract in order to meet Polifin`s financial year end.
The site, which covers over 16 kilometres, was developed in the late sixties, thus rendering the telecommunications infrastructure obsolete. Facilities were limited and spares not readily available, with prolonged failures and high running costs the end result.
The project was based on Philips` SOPHO iS3000, which is ideally suited for Polifin`s purposes. The specification called for a PBX network, based on a five node system interconnected via the existing fibre optic cable. In order to minimise costs and inconvenience, the existing peripheral cable system was retained.
The signalling system chosen for the Polifin Midland network was DPNSS, giving Polifin flexibility to expand, or alter, the network. Furthermore, DPNSS is an internationally accepted, feature rich signalling system
A number of firsts were achieved on this project including it being the first multi-nodal, management package to maintain the infrastructure needs in a package which gives access to all nodes in a structured method. Furthermore, it utilises free numbering: each extension can be assigned any number, and this extension can be located anywhere in the network.
According to PBC, the new system is a platform for Polifin`s future growth and integration into the overall Sasol network. Not only will Polifin save money and increase efficiencies, but further benefits are ISDN services and digital telephones available throughout the plant.
